Plain-Language Summary

Virginia's law requires the Supreme Court's Office of the Executive Secretary to develop and conduct evaluations of all local specialty dockets, including veterans courts. These evaluations are reported annually to the General Assembly. Additionally, veterans dockets are recognized as Veterans Treatment Court Programs eligible for federal and other funding sources.
